BufferCacheEntry.cs
1 namespace Ryujinx.Graphics.Gpu.Memory 2 { 3 /// <summary> 4 /// A cached entry for easily locating a buffer that is used often internally. 5 /// </summary> 6 class BufferCacheEntry 7 { 8 /// <summary> 9 /// The CPU VA of the buffer destination. 10 /// </summary> 11 public ulong Address; 12 13 /// <summary> 14 /// The end GPU VA of the associated buffer, used to check if new data can fit. 15 /// </summary> 16 public ulong EndGpuAddress; 17 18 /// <summary> 19 /// The buffer associated with this cache entry. 20 /// </summary> 21 public Buffer Buffer; 22 23 /// <summary> 24 /// The UnmappedSequence of the buffer at the time of creation. 25 /// If this differs from the value currently in the buffer, then this cache entry is outdated. 26 /// </summary> 27 public int UnmappedSequence; 28 29 /// <summary> 30 /// Create a new cache entry. 31 /// </summary> 32 /// <param name="address">The CPU VA of the buffer destination</param> 33 /// <param name="gpuVa">The GPU VA of the buffer destination</param> 34 /// <param name="buffer">The buffer object containing the target buffer</param> 35 public BufferCacheEntry(ulong address, ulong gpuVa, Buffer buffer) 36 { 37 Address = address; 38 EndGpuAddress = gpuVa + (buffer.EndAddress - address); 39 Buffer = buffer; 40 UnmappedSequence = buffer.UnmappedSequence; 41 } 42 } 43 }
